Chemical & Physical Properties

Density0.986 g/mL at 25 °C(lit.)
Boiling Point119-121 °C15 mm Hg(lit.)
Melting Point<-35ºC
Molecular FormulaC13H20O2
Molecular Weight208.29700
Flash Point207 °F
Exact Mass208.14600
PSA26.30000
LogP2.93040
Index of Refractionn20/D 1.476(lit.)
InChIKeyPSGCQDPCAWOCSH-CWSCBRNRSA-N
SMILESC=CC(=O)OC1CC2CCC1(C)C2(C)C
